The global Gases for Epitaxy market is projected to grow from US$ 1726 million in 2024 to US$ 2839 million by 2031, at a CAGR of 7.1% (2025-2031), driven by critical product segments and diverse end‑use applications.
Electronic gases can be categorized by manufacturing process, including crystal growth gases, thermal oxidation gases, epitaxial gases, doping gases, diffusion gases, chemical vapor deposition gases, ion implantation gases, etching gases, carrier gases/purge gases, photolithography gases, and annealing gases. Epitaxy is the process of depositing and growing a single crystal material on a substrate surface. The gases used to grow one or more layers of material are called epitaxial gases. Commonly used silicon epitaxial gases include DCS, SiCl4, and SiH4.
